Given her last physical exam results, Rashidah’s physician believes
she has likely had undiagnosed atherosclerosis for years. Briefly
describe the pathophysiology of atherosclerosis.
Selec Atherosclerosis is the buildup of plaque, which contains fats and cholesterol, on
ted the inner layers of the arterial walls. Instead of being smooth and elastic, the
Answ layers become thickened and irregular with the lumen of the artery becoming
er: narrower. This leads to reduced circulation of blood and can lead to elevated
blood pressure.
